Output 9a625701113c55f5d9a63d180d040d0e21006dc0af896562465105f821c9c4ad:0

value
608760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 904b72dbf4f85079c710c5c74f62421f9caf2c84 OP_EQUAL
address
3EqycS41BbXPQWmNrV246DHVheNP5JHzzn
transaction
9a625701113c55f5d9a63d180d040d0e21006dc0af896562465105f821c9c4ad
spent
true